摘要
Classical TC analysis of films supported on micro-cover glasses was performed in order to determine the appropriate processing temperature to achieve electrochemically active NiOxHy thin films. As deposited films made from three different precursors (Ni-acetate, nitrate and sulphate) and their corresponding powders were also investigated. From dynamic TG measurements the onset decomposition temperature could be determined. It was found out that the starting temperature of the mass change of thin films is approximately 30 degrees lower than that of the powders. A broader decomposition range was also observed for thin films. Furthermore, the isothermal treatment of films deposited on conducting substrate at 270 and 300 degrees C was performed and by cyclic voltametry the importance of temperature and time of heating was proved. Films obtained at higher temperatures (>300 degrees C) are electrochemically inert because of the NiO phase formation.
